# Analysis of Life Magazine Page 355 This page contains two satirical pieces: **"Olympus Up to Date"** (top illustration) depicts classical Greek gods and goddesses in a modern setting, apparently a crowded public transit car or social venue. The satire mocks how even mythological figures can't escape contemporary urban annoyances—crowding, rudeness, and discomfort. **"Modern Conversations"** (text below) presents a dialogue between men and women discussing cable cars, standing room, and seating—mundane urban transit complaints. The satire targets gender relations, showing men as selfish ("Men are so selfish, aren't they?") and women frustrated by male entitlement to comfort. **"Down in Front"** (portrait right) appears to be a separate comic commentary, likely referencing theater etiquette complaints. Overall, the page satirizes modern urban life's indignities affecting everyone.
